TheVWL's Core Values and Commitments for the Planet

TheVWL collective is 100% vegan and cruelty-free. The brand and the designers aim to awaken people's consciousness on environmental matters. TheVWL products are mainly made of certified vegan materials, recycled, organic, and free from harmful substances: proudly and actively part of the change of the fashion industry towards a cleaner planet.

TheVWL use bio-certifies eco leathers with PU made from a renewable source, where 48% of corn-based polyols content replaces petroleum-derived materials. This material is water-based and solvent-free, contributing to lower CO2 emissions.

Recycled polyesters are sourced from post-consumer plastic bottles; the yarn is produced through a non-chemical but mechanical process. This alternative textile as well is water-based and solvent-free, and its production lowers CO2 emissions by 50%.

To deliver its eco-conscious collection, TheVWL pack and ship sustainably by using 100% recycled cardboard and vegetable ink print.
